Chippewa Nature Center (CNC) is a non-profit organization that works to connect all people to nature through educational, recreational and cultural experiences. CNC's gardens include native plant gardens, homestead gardens, and children's gardens. The goal of each garden is to connect visitors and program participants with nature in a meaningful way. CNC has 19 miles of trails, a Visitor Center with indoor and outdoor exhibits, Nature Education Center, Nature Preschool, Homestead Farm and Log Schoolhouse situated on 2,000 acres at the confluence of the Pine and Chippewa rivers.

Overview : CNC is a nonprofit, environmental education organization. Its mission is to connect all people to nature through educational, recreational and cultural experiences. The 2,000-acre property includes woodlands, fields, ponds and rivers. CNC's facilities consist of a Visitor Center with a River Overlook, Ecosystem Gallery, Wildlife Viewing Area and more; an 1870s Homestead Farm complex; Nature Education Center; Nature Preschool; an arboretum and 19 miles of trails.
